  Finding Motivation: What to Tell Yourself When You Don't Feel Like Studying   Studying is a journey paved with challenges, and it's completely normal to encounter moments when motivation wanes. Whether you're a student navigating through textbooks or someone preparing for an exam or certification, the struggle to muster the energy and focus to study is a common one. In these moments, it's essential to have strategies in place to reignite that spark of motivation. Here's what you can tell yourself when you find yourself in a study slump: 1. Remember Your Goals: Take a moment to remind yourself why you started this journey in the first place. Visualize your goals and the rewards awaiting you at the end of your efforts. Whether it's acing an exam, pursuing a career path, or simply expanding your knowledge, keeping your goals in mind can reignite your passion for learning. 2.   Striking the Right Balance: A Guide to Juggling Work and Study In the fast-paced world we live in, many individuals find themselves navigating the delicate balance between pursuing their education and working to make ends meet. Balancing work and study can be challenging, but with the right strategies, it's not only possible but can also lead to personal and professional growth. In this blog post, we'll explore practical tips and insights to help you strike the right balance between your work commitments and academic pursuits. Create a Realistic Schedule: Begin by creating a realistic and achievable schedule that accommodates both your work and study commitments. Clearly outline your work hours, class schedule, and designated study times. Be mindful of your energy levels and allocate time for breaks to avoid burnout.  Productive after school night routine for 2024 1.Game Plan: Right after school, I make a quick to-do list. Nothing fancy, just a simple plan for the evening. It keeps me on track and makes sure I don't forget anything important. Snack Time: Before hitting the books, I grab a snack. It's a small thing, but it keeps me from feeling like a zombie during study time. Phone Break: An hour before bed, I turn off my phone and other gadgets. It's like a mini vacation from screens, and it helps me relax before hitting the hay. Study Hacks: When I'm studying, I use tricks like the Pomodoro Technique. Short bursts of focus with breaks in between—it's like a power-up for my brain. Set Up for Tomorrow: Before crashing out, I get my stuff ready for the next day. It saves me from morning chaos and gives me a few extra minutes of sleep. Chill Time: I take a few minutes to chill out before bed. Maybe some light stretching or just deep breathing.  Unleash Your Full Potential: Strategies to Improve Focus and Productivity      Introduction:    In a world full of distractions and our constant attention spans, staying focused and productive has become an invaluable skill. Whether you're a student, professional or entrepreneur, optimizing your ability to focus and be productive can increase efficiency and success. In this blog, we  explore various pro tips and strategies to help you  focus and improve your productivity.     Create a distraction-free enviro nment:    Designate a specific study or work area that is free of distractions. Minimize external interruptions by turning off notifications on  electronic devices and keeping non-essential items away. Top 21 Memorizing tips for Students         As a student, one of the most valuable skills you can possess is a strong memory. From facts and figures to vocabulary and formulas, there is always something new to learn and remember. Fortunately, there are many effective techniques that can help you improve your memory and retain information more efficiently. These tips will help you remember things and help you to achieve excellent grades.Here are the 21 tips that you can follow.  1. Set Goals: Before you begin studying, set realistic goals for what you want to learn. Break the information down into manageable chunks to make it more digestible. 2. Use Repetition: Repeating information over and over again can help you commit it to memory. Practice makes perfect! 3. Use Mnemonics: Mnemonics are memory aids that help you remember information by associating it with something else.
